Rashford Set for Season-Long Loan Move to Barcelona
Marcus Rashford is on the brink of a season-long loan move to FC Barcelona, following a green light from Manchester United for the forward to enter negotiations with the La Liga champions, according to ESPN. The 27-year-old has been training away from the first-team squad at United for the past two weeks after head coach Ruben Amorim informed him that he does not fit into the club’s plans.
Rashford’s potential transfer to Barcelona comes after a previous loan in the last season did not progress into a permanent transfer, despite a pre-agreed fee of £40 million (approximately $53.6 million). Sources indicate that Rashford has consistently favored a move to Barcelona since the possibility first arose in January.
After missing out on their top target, who opted to re-sign with another club, Barcelona has shifted its focus to Rashford. United has reportedly agreed to a loan arrangement that includes an option for Barcelona to secure the player on a permanent basis.
Rashford, who has three years remaining on his contract worth £325,000 per week, has made an impressive impact at United, netting 138 goals in 426 appearances since his debut as an 18-year-old in February 2016. His contributions have been pivotal in securing victories for United, including triumphs in the Europa League and two FA Cup titles.
Despite his storied career at Old Trafford, Rashford has not participated in a match since facing Viktoria Plzen in the Europa League last December. Amorim’s decision to exclude him from the squad for a recent 2-1 victory has left Rashford without a place in the first-team lineup.
Now, with permission granted to his representatives to engage in discussions with Barcelona, the forward stands at a critical juncture in his career. While no formal agreement has been reached among all parties, the move appears to be progressing.
